前端 Web 开发 - 学习 HTML5 和 CSS3
Front-End Web Development - Learn HTML5 and CSS3
- 1 - Welcome
- 2 - Course goals
- 3 - Course outline
- 4 - Selecting your editor
- 7 - Browser development tools
- 9 - Introduction to HTML
- 10 - What is HTML
- 11 - Anatomy of a page
- 12 - Semantic tags
- 13 - Common tags
- 14 - Layout tags
- 16 - Working with text
- 17 - Working with images
- 18 - Image formats
- 19 - Working with forms
- 21 - HTML challenge solution
- 22 - Module introduction
- 23 - Anchor tags
- 24 - Inpage links
- 25 - Tables
- 26 - File uploads
- 27 - Video
- 28 - Audio
- 29 - Preloading media
- 30 - Introduction to CSS
- 31 - What is CSS
- 32 - Creating a stylesheet
- 33 - Adding styles
- 34 - Selectors
- 35 - Types of selectors
- 36 - Editing CSS live
- 37 - Properties
- 38 - Sizing boxes
- 40 - Display property
- 41 - Designing layouts
- 42 - Flexbox in detail
- 43 - Media queries
- 45 - CSS project example
- 46 - Module introduction
- 47 - Background images
- 48 - Gradients
- 49 - Overflow
- 50 - Pseudoelements
- 51 - Transitions
- 52 - Variables
- 53 - Introduction to SEO
- 54 - What is SEO
- 55 - Modern SEO
- 56 - Page structure
- 57 - Meta tags
- 58 - Robotstxt
- 59 - Introduction to tools
- 60 - Can I Use
- 61 - Lighthouse
- 62 - W3C Validator
- 63 - Colour tools
- 64 - Introduction to CSS Grid
- 65 - What is grid
- 66 - Browser support
- 68 - Templates
- 69 - Repeats
- 70 - Gaps
- 71 - Units of measurement
- 72 - Alignment and justification
- 73 - Implicit tracks
- 74 - Positioning items
- 75 - Areas
- 76 - Minmax
- 77 - Autofill
- 78 - Introduction to projects
- 79 - Twocolumn layout
- 80 - Article blog
- 81 - Photo blog
- 82 - Article with breakout
- 83 - Whats next
- 84 - Conclusion